If you want to show a picture, first you have to find a place on the internet to store your picture,(the hard drive on-your computer won't work). Try going to http://www.photohost.org The guy there was giving out free photo hosting web space.
After you get your picture uploaded to your host site. you will have a URL address. like this. http://temp.corvetteforum.net/c3/desertdawg//freepost.gif

You will need to highlight and copy that, then go to your "profile" ( its in the menu on the top left of every CF page you see.) There you can add it to your signature, to do this you will need to click on the button. it will display a set of tags like this [img] [/img) you need to paste your URL address between them.
[img] http://temp.corvetteforum.net/c3/desertdawg//freepost.gif [/img)

You can also add any picture you want to your replies, by following the same procedure listed above...
